MOLINOS, Rita. Levels of life: Biographic dimensions. An. Inst. Arte Am. Investig. Estét. Mario J. Buschiazzo [online]. 2019, vol.49, n.2, pp.259-272. ISSN 2362-2024.

Biography includes the history of a life (individual or collective), the narrative configuration that deals with that history and the writing of that narrative, and can be considered as a field, genre and resource. Under the proposal of François Dosse, the ages of its production (and consumption) have had different articulations, approaches and accents and have maintained distances, divergences and coincidences with the thinking of historians. The editorial formats and the biographical eagerness (even more in the disciplinary field of architecture) have resulted in rigid formats in which names and canon hegemonize writing while suppressing, among other elements, the approaches of biographical research.

Keywords : biography; history; format; canon.
